On September 13, Bandai Namco Entertainment announced the launch of the first console game project in THE IDOLM@STER SideM series. Currently under development, the new title will be released on Nintendo Switch and Nintendo Switch 2, though the official name and release date have yet to be announced.
The new title will continue the worldview of the existing stories on THE IDOLM@STER SideM brand page while presenting an entirely original storyline for the console version. The story revolves around a major live performance held one year later, featuring 49 idols from 16 units working towards their respective goals.
The main characters of THE IDOLM@STER SideM are all male idols, each with a professional background before becoming idols, such as doctors. Players take on the role of a producer at the 315 Production agency, responsible for nurturing these members who have chosen the path of idolhood for various reasons.
The series previously launched mobile games THE IDOLM@STER SideM LIVE ON ST@GE! and THE IDOLM@STER SideM GROWING STARS, but both titles have ceased operations. Excluding crossover titles that feature characters from multiple brands, this project marks the first standalone console game for THE IDOLM@STER SideM.
This also marks the first console game in THE IDOLM@STER series since THE IDOLM@STER Starlit Season in 2021. The project is currently in development, and Bandai Namco Entertainment will gradually reveal more details, including the official title and release date.
